Output 98f76763d0d2ae81ac14508a23b7733c6f5de5bf8d3f563a7c30ecf55eb04095:0

value
3673288588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ace4ccf1370a7387e503943c30d1096fe617ba0a OP_EQUAL
address
MPfLYmQB1o8V5uSgpD4UvDtdsvoagwpZiR
transaction
98f76763d0d2ae81ac14508a23b7733c6f5de5bf8d3f563a7c30ecf55eb04095
spent
true